ANGI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2020 in Review
141 of the 5,676 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Angi Inc (ANGI) for Q4 2020, worth a combined $1.03B — up 39% from $740M a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 39 funds closed out of ANGI and 31 opened new positions — a net loss of 8 holders — while 46 trimmed existing stakes and 44 added.
The largest buyer was Parnassus Investments, opening a new position worth an estimated $123M. The largest seller was Durable Capital Partners, exiting entirely with an estimated $38.6M sold.
